Value R (Stable and Dynamic)

One of the most important factors to consider when selecting the best heat insulation materials for commercial and residential properties are the R-value. The capabilities of these materials to provide heat insulation these materials decrease in time due the properties of air which is typically mentioned in the warranties of their products. The R-value is the most impacted by temperature, therefore the preferred choice of materials must differ from region location.

Beautiful stability

Temperature not only impacts the R-value but also affects the dimensional stability of materials. An insulation material that expands and contracts during temperature fluctuations can have a major negative effect on the performance of the building envelope. For the best longevity, you should focus on materials that have an lower linear expansion coefficient, as they limit the changes in cracks that are open, for example.

Breathability

Damage to the moisture is among the main reasons for problems with the building envelope. It can cause serious functional and structural damage to your house. Permeable materials that allow ample space for ventilation and drying moisture are essential to minimise the risk of problems related to moisture.

Spray foam serves as an air-tight barrier, thus preventing air leakage from cracks and voids. It can be extremely effective in reducing energy consumption by increasing the efficiency of thermal energy in the structure.
